网上下载了ali-iot-c-link-sdk,例程是STM32L476的,编译后ZI-DATA占89K.
我想用stm32f103XC系列的单片机,ram是没这么大的。就像找下程序里哪里占用了这么大的空间,看能否改小些。
那么,如何找到ZI-DATA这些变量的位置呢?
在map文件里看到heap_4.o文件占用近82K。
那么下一步改如何进一步定位呢?
该例程用的是freertos。
离线
看样子应该搜下工程里调用malloc的地方了。
离线
freertos的配置文件里找找。是不是给系统配置了80多K的ram。
是的,谢谢,改小后,可以在cb芯片里跑起来了。又遇到了其它问题,正在查。
离线